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Buffy-headed Marmoset | Checkered Woodpecker |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Piciformes (Piciformes) |
| Family | Callitrichidae | Picidae |
| Genus | Callithrix | Veniliornis |
| Species | Callithrix flaviceps | Veniliornis mixtus |
